There’s a new trailer for A Bigger Splash, the upcoming drama movie starring Tilda Swinton, Matthias Schoenaerts, Ralph Fiennes, and Dakota Johnson:
A BIGGER SPLASHPlot synopsis:
“Rock legend Marianne Lane (Tilda Swinton) is recuperating on the volcanic island of Pantelleria with her partner Paul (Matthias Schoenaerts), when iconoclast record producer and old flame Harry (Ralph Fiennes) unexpectedly arrives with his daughter Penelope (Dakota Johnson and interrupts their holiday, bringing with him an A-bomb blast of delirious nostalgia from which there can be no rescue. A Bigger Splash is a sensuous portrait of laughter, desire, and rock and roll detonating into violence under the Mediterranean sun.”

You may watch below the official trailer of Oddball aka Oddball and the Penguins, the latest family movie directed by Stuart McDonald based on a script by Peter Ivan:
ODDBALLPlot synopsis:
“The true story about an eccentric chicken farmer (Shane Jacobson) who, with the help of his granddaughter, trains his mischievous dog Oddball to protect a wild penguin sanctuary from fox attacks and in the process tries to reunite his family and save their seaside town.”

The film is starring a dog, a few penguins, Shane Jacobson, Coco Jack Gillies, Sarah Snook, and Alan Tudyk. It was released in Australia on September 15, 2015 and will hit UK theaters on February 12, 2016.

This new preview clip of Kung Fu Panda 3, the upcoming animated movie sequel from Dreamworks Animation, features Po (voiced by Jack Black) and Li Shan, his biological father (voiced by Bryan Cranston):
Kung Fu Panda 3 – Hall of heroesPlot synopsis:
“Po (Jack Black) reunites with his biological father (Bryan Cranston) and travels with him to a secret sanctuary of pandas where, to his surprise, he does not fit in. There he meets Mei Mei (Kate Hudson), an overly eager panda, who had been promised to Po through an arranged marriage when they were children. To make matters worse, an evil ancient spirit called Kai (J.K. Simmons) begins terrorizing China and stealing the powers of defeated kung fu masters. Now in the face of incredible odds, Po must learn to train a village of clumsy, fun-loving pandas to become a band of Kung Fu Pandas.”
